    What's Included

    Mobile diagnostic service means a certified technician brings professional-grade diagnostic equipment directly to your home, office, or roadside location. We connect to your vehicle's onboard computer, read diagnostic trouble codes (DTCs), test sensors and components, and identify the root cause of warning lights or performance problems. Modern vehicles contain sophisticated computer systems that monitor hundreds of sensors and components. When something goes wrong, the computer stores a diagnostic code and illuminates a warning light. Our technicians use professional scan tools to read these codes, interpret what they mean, and perform hands-on testing to confirm the diagnosis.

      Comprehensive Diagnostic Services

      OBD-II Computer Diagnostics

      We connect to your vehicle's OBD-II (On-Board Diagnostics) port using professional-grade scan tools that read diagnostic codes, view live sensor data, and perform system tests. This gives us detailed information about what's triggering warning lights or causing performance issues.

      Check Engine Light Diagnosis

      The check engine light can indicate anything from a loose gas cap to a serious engine problem. We read the stored codes, research the specific codes for your vehicle, test related components, and pinpoint the exact cause. You'll receive a clear explanation of the problem and a detailed quote for repairs.

      Sensor Testing and Diagnosis

      Modern engines rely on sensors including oxygen sensors, mass airflow sensors, throttle position sensors, coolant temperature sensors, and camshaft/crankshaft position sensors. We test sensors using diagnostic tools and multimeters to identify failed or failing sensors.

      Electrical System Diagnostics

      Electrical problems can be challenging to diagnose, but our technicians use systematic diagnostic procedures to identify wiring issues, failed modules, faulty switches, and electrical shorts. From charging system problems to parasitic battery drains, we find and fix electrical issues.

      Performance Diagnostics

      If your vehicle runs rough, lacks power, hesitates, or stalls, we perform comprehensive performance diagnostics including compression testing, fuel pressure testing, ignition system testing, and emissions system evaluation.

      Emission System Diagnostics

      Failed emissions tests or emission-related warning lights require specialized diagnostics. We test catalytic converters, evaporative emission systems (EVAP), EGR systems, and oxygen sensors to identify emissions problems.

      Transmission Diagnostics

      Transmission warning lights, harsh shifting, or slipping require transmission-specific diagnostics. We read transmission codes, check fluid condition, and test transmission operation to diagnose transmission issues.

      Common Dashboard Warning Lights We Diagnose

      Check Engine Light (Service Engine Soon)

      The most common warning light. Indicates an emissions or engine-related problem stored in the computer. Requires diagnostic scanning and component testing.

      ABS Light (Anti-Lock Brake System)

      Indicates a problem with the anti-lock brake system. Common causes include wheel speed sensors, ABS modules, or low brake fluid.

      Airbag Light (SRS)

      Indicates a problem with the airbag system. Requires specialized diagnostics to identify faulty sensors, wiring, or control modules.

      Battery/Charging System Light

      Indicates a charging system problem—typically a failing alternator, bad battery, or loose connection.

      Traction Control / Stability Control Light

      Often related to ABS system issues, wheel speed sensors, or steering angle sensors.

      Tire Pressure Warning Light (TPMS)

      Indicates low tire pressure or a faulty tire pressure sensor. We check tire pressures and diagnose TPMS sensor issues.

      Oil Pressure Warning Light

      Serious warning indicating low oil pressure. Requires immediate diagnosis to prevent engine damage.

      Coolant Temperature Warning Light

      Indicates engine overheating. Requires immediate diagnosis to identify cooling system problems.

      Our Mobile Diagnostic Process

      1

      Connect Diagnostic Scanner

      We connect our professional scan tool to your vehicle's OBD-II port and retrieve all stored diagnostic trouble codes (DTCs), pending codes, and freeze frame data.

      2

      Read and Research Codes

      Diagnostic codes point us toward the problem area, but they don't tell the complete story. We research the codes specific to your vehicle make, model, and year to understand common causes and diagnostic procedures.

      3

      Test Related Components

      Based on the codes and symptoms, we perform hands-on testing of the related components—checking sensors, testing circuits, measuring voltages, and verifying mechanical operation.

      4

      Confirm Diagnosis

      We don't guess. We test until we're certain of the diagnosis. Once confirmed, we provide a clear explanation of the problem in terms you'll understand.

      5

      Provide Quote and Recommendations

      You'll receive a detailed quote for the necessary repairs including parts and labor. We explain why the repair is needed and what happens if it's not addressed.

      6

      Clear Codes (After Repairs)

      After completing repairs, we clear diagnostic codes and verify the warning lights don't return. We may perform a road test to confirm proper operation.
